Randomness Source Certification

Algorithm

Randomness Source Certification validates the deterministic output of a pseudorandom number generator (PRNG) against statistical tests, ensuring unpredictability crucial for fair execution in decentralized applications. Within cryptocurrency, this certification mitigates manipulation risks in areas like NFT minting and on-chain gaming, where biased randomness compromises user experience and value. Options trading and financial derivatives rely on verifiable randomness for fair pricing and settlement of exotic contracts, particularly those dependent on simulations or Monte Carlo methods. A robust certification process, often involving cryptographic commitments and verifiable delay functions, establishes trust in the integrity of the randomness generation process.